Fat-Free Cabbage-Rice Casserole

⏱ 115 mins 🍽 8 serving(s) 🏷 Greens

This satisfying casserole is a fat-free meal option, with the exception of optional Parmesan cheese. It combines sliced cabbage, uncooked rice, and a mix of vegetables like onion, carrots, and green pepper. The ingredients are baked together in a tomato-based sauce flavoured with brown sugar, vinegar, and Dijon mustard. The result is a tender, flavourful dish that serves eight people. You can customise it with a sprinkle of cheese or add dried chilli flakes for a spicy kick.

Fat-Free Cabbage-Rice Casserole

Ingredients

  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 1 -2 tablespoon fresh minced garlic
  • 7 cups cabbage, sliced (about 1/2 head)
  • 3 large carrots (peeled and thinly sliced)
  • 1 large green bell pepper, seeded and coarsley chopped
  • 1 1/2 cups uncooked rice
  • 2 (28 ounce) cans diced tomatoes (including the juice, do not drain)
  • 1 cup tomato juice
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ar (or to taste)
  • 1/2 cup white vinegar
  • salt and pepper
  • 1 -2 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 4 -6 whole tomatoes, chopped (optional)

Method

  1. Preheat your oven to 350 degrees.
  2. Lightly grease a large casserole dish with a capacity of at least 16 cups, or prepare two smaller dishes.
  3. Arrange the chopped onion and minced garlic across the base of the greased dish.
  4. Slice the cabbage with a knife or food processor to yield approximately 7 cups.
  5. Combine all the chopped vegetables and the uncooked rice in a large mixing bowl.
  6. In a separate bowl, mix the canned diced tomatoes with their juice, 1 cup tomato juice, sugar, vinegar, salt, pepper and Dijon mustard thoroughly.
  7. Fold this tomato mixture into the bowl of cabbage and rice until everything is evenly coated.
  8. Pour the combined mixture over the onions in the casserole dish without stirring, then cover it with a lid.
  9. Bake for 1-1/2 hours, stirring the contents well every half an hour, until the cabbage is soft and the rice is cooked.
  10. If using, stir the chopped fresh tomatoes into the baked casserole.
  11. For a cheesy topping, you may optionally sprinkle 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ese over the casserole before baking.
